Slightly behind Ott Tänak (Hyundai) and Sébastien Ogier (Toyota) lors de la première épreuve spéciale de l’année, Thierry Neuville and Nicolas Gilsoul (Hyundai) turned things around in a very good way. The Belgians, motivated by a partially icy road, distanced the two world champion crews by almost 30″!
They logically take the lead in the general classification after these two night specials. Behind, a trio composed of Ogier, Tänak and Evans (Toyota) stands half a minute behind. The titled nonuples Sébastien Loeb and Daniel Elena are even further away, at 51″! After a thunderous start, Kalle Rovanperä (Toyota) preferred to play the cautious card (+1'15").
Hopes of a good result have already vanished for Teemu Suninen (Ford). The Finn suffered a transmission problem on his Ford Fiesta and parked on the side of the road while Gus Greensmith briefly parked.
